Wells Fargo is seeking a Lead Data Analyst to join the BSA/AML Data Product and Transformation team. Wells Fargo is embarking on a multiyear transformation journey aimed at building a centralized capability to store, manage and analyze Financial Crimes Compliance Operations (FCO) data to fulfill the Bank's BSA/AML regulatory, compliance and risk commitments. Wells Fargo is seeking a candidate with deep expertise in data transformation and data product management as well as experience with either BSA/AML, operations, and/or technology to solve key strategic problems associated with the transformation effort.
The BSA/AML Data Transformation team will deliver to our stakeholders curated data products, which are valuable, understandable, and trustworthy (among other attributes) to our stakeholders, the Operations and Risk analytics communities. These products will directly support their ability to leverage Wells Fargo data assets for insight generation.
Success in this role will enable faster delivery of the program's objectives, which include standing up data products to drive our regulatory, compliance, and risk commitments.
In this role, you will:
- Advise line of business and companywide functions on business strategies based on research of performance metrics, trends in population distributions, and other complex data analysis to maximize profits and asset growth, and minimize operating losses within risk and other operating standards
- Work with data partners to develop requirements to accurately identify populations that require remediation.
- Convert complex business requirements into actionable technical requirements.
- Assist with the development of code to satisfy the requirements.
- Lead initiatives across multiple lines of business to create consistency while gaining approval and support of senior leadership.
- Identify gaps or inconsistencies within requirements and work toward an effective solution.
- Provide influence and leadership in the identification of new tools and methods to analyze data
- Ensure adherence to compliance and legal regulations and policies on all projects managed
- Provide updates on project logs, monthly budget forecasts, monthly newsletters, and operations reviews
- Assist managers in building quarterly and annual plans and forecast future market research needs for business partners supported
- Strategically collaborate and consult with peers, colleagues, and mid-level-to-senior managers to resolve issues and achieve goals
- Lead projects, teams, or serve as a peer mentor to staff, interns and external contractors
- 5+ years of Risk Analytics experience, or equivalent demonstrated through one or a combination of the following: work experience, training, military experience, education
- Ability to work and influence successfully within a matrix environment by establishing and maintaining effective working relationships with all levels of the organization.
- Knowledge and understanding of business requirements gathering and translation to technical requirements.
- Problem solving using data and business knowledge.
- Experience with BSA/AML customer and product data.
- Knowledge of the modern data stack and experience performing complex data analysis, research, and visualization using tools such as SQL, SAS, Power BI, Alteryx, etc.
- Familiar with large relational databases.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with high attention to detail and with sound business judgment; ability to interpret analytical problems.
- Familiar with Hadoop, Google BigQuery, Spark, AI development tools, and/or similar tools.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ene
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.
Key Facts About Charlotte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
-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
-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
-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
-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
